#5205 With the wisdom, humor, curiosity, and sharp insights that have brought millions of readers to his New York Times column, David Brooks now focuses on the deeper values that should inform our lives.
Responding to what he calls the culture of the Big Me, which emphasizes external success, Brooks challenges us to rebalance the scales between our resume virtues achieving wealth, fame, and status and our eulogy virtues, those that exist at the core of our being: kindness, bravery, honesty, or faithfulness, focusing on what kind of relationships we have formed.
Blending psychology, politics, spirituality, and confessional, this book provides an opportunity for us to rethink our priorities, and strive to build rich inner lives marked by humility and moral depth.
